Subject: Winding down the Thornbury office

Hi all — as discussed at last month's board session, we're moving ahead with closing the Thornbury office. It's down to six people, and the lease renewal quote from the landlord made the decision easier. Everyone there has been offered remote arrangements or a transfer to Gellart House; so far the response has been positive. Savings land around mid next year. Margo will handle the comms plan. The wider rationale is summarised below.

board note of kagep-yahig: Only 9 of the 120 pilot accounts renewed Quenix, so a churn review is set for April 1.

Hey Priya — handing off the Gatewick rate-limiter work before the release. Token bucket is now per-client instead of global, so the burst complaints from the Falcrest team should stop. One gotcha: the limits reload only on restart, not SIGHUP. Everything else is stable in staging. The current values we're shipping with are listed below.

settings of tagef-bawif:
DRUIX_HOST=druix.zemvarlabs.internal
DRUIX_PORT=8000

### Step 4: Tax-Rate Lookup Cache

Before starting the Fennelworth checkout service, warm the tax-rate lookup cache by running the seed job against the rates snapshot. Confirm the cache TTL matches the jurisdiction refresh window (24h) and that stale entries are evicted, not served. The cache node authenticates to the rates upstream using a token stored in the env file; it belongs on the next line.

vault entry, yahif-yajep: COURIER_KEY29=b802bdf8034096b65a51c6ba5abe2

# Spoolhop Environments

Quick tour for reviewers: Spoolhop (our printer-spooler microservice) runs in three environments — sandbox, staging, and prod. Sandbox uses fake printers that accept everything, so don't trust green checks there. Staging talks to the actual test fleet in the Darnley office. When reviewing config changes, diff against prod, not staging. The current prod settings are listed below.

config for yajep-tafof:
[rusath]
team = julmir
access_code = ac_fe37fd
host = rusath.novactech.test
port = 8000
owner = pelmir.weneth
peer = oliwyn.olvarqdyn.internal